After getting the long 75mm and the 76mm, the Shermans went waay better then the one with the short barrel, also the Jumbos are - if angeled - really hard to kill from the front.
PS: My suggestion would be - go for the M36 Jackson first, then for M41 Bulldog, they got both 6.3, but they are ! way ! better then the Shermans. M36 got a 90mm gun, which can actually one hit most tanks, and the M41 Bulldog got a BETTER 76mm gun wich can load later on Sabot shells, also hes quite small and fast, which allows awesome rush & camp flanks. EDIT: Also for your "shot spread", that could be because you didnt skilled "targeting & rangefinding" in ur crew's skills, one is for faster aiming, the other for more accurate shots, both are very good ones, and also needed for long shots.
